About this trial

The goal of this clinical trial is to test whether a nurse-led program can improve screening and referral rates for sexual dysfunction and improve sexual health care in individuals with gynecological cancer. The main questions it aims to answer are:

Does participation in a nurse-led program improve the treatment of sexual dysfunction in individuals with gynecological cancer?

Does the program increase the frequency of screenings and referrals for sexual dysfunction?

Participants will:

Complete a visit with an advanced practice provider.

Fill out the Female Sexual Function Index survey.

Allow the research team to review medical records.

Eligibility criteria

Qualifiers

Patients with a gynecologic cancer history

Patients ages 30-65 years old

Patients must have completed cancer treatment within the past 12 months

Patients may be on maintenance therapy

Disqualifiers

None
